为什么 Minecraft 1.10.2 依然流行?
在讨论如何搭建服务器之前,了解它的魅力所在很重要:

(图片来源网络,侵删)
- 经典模组时代:1.10.2 是模组“黄金时代”的巅峰之一,许多著名的模组(如 Thaumcraft 6, Tinkers' Construct 2, Mekanism 5, Twilight Forest 2.x 等)都在这个版本达到了稳定且功能完善的巅峰状态,对于老玩家来说,1.10.2 承载了无数美好的回忆。
- 平衡性好:相比更早的版本(如 1.7.10),1.10.2 在原版游戏机制上更加成熟和平衡,加入了盾牌、骨粉催化的特性,优化了战斗和农业体验。
- 社区庞大:由于历史悠久,围绕 1.10.2 的社区、教程、资源包和模组包极其丰富,无论是寻找问题解决方案还是寻找新的玩法,都能轻松找到帮助。
- 性能相对优秀:对于当时的硬件来说,1.10.2 的性能表现良好,即使在配置不算高的服务器上也能流畅运行,吸引了大量主机和小型服务器。
如何搭建一个 Minecraft 1.10.2 服务器?
搭建服务器主要有两种方式:官方原版服务器 和 模组服务器。
搭建官方原版服务器
如果你想玩的是没有模组的“纯净服”,这是最简单的方式。
准备工作:
- 一台性能尚可的电脑(作为服务器)。
- 稳定的网络环境,最好有公网 IP 或使用内网穿透工具(如花生壳)。
- Java 8 运行环境(JDK 8)。这是关键! 1.10.2 只能完美运行在 Java 8 上,更高版本的 Java 可能会导致兼容性问题。
步骤:

(图片来源网络,侵删)
-
下载服务器端文件:
- 访问 Minecraft 官方历史版本页面:https://www.minecraft.net/en-us/download/versions
- 找到 Minecraft 1.10.2,点击 "minecraft_server.1.10.2.jar" 下载。
-
创建服务器文件夹:
- 在你的电脑上新建一个文件夹,
MC_Server_1.10.2。 - 将下载好的
minecraft_server.1.10.2.jar文件放入这个文件夹。
- 在你的电脑上新建一个文件夹,
-
首次启动生成配置文件:
- 打开命令行(Windows下是CMD或PowerShell,macOS/Linux下是Terminal)。
- 使用
cd命令切换到你刚刚创建的文件夹路径。cd C:\Users\YourUser\Desktop\MC_Server_1.10.2 - 运行命令:
java -Xms1G -Xmx1G -jar minecraft_server.1.10.2.jar nogui-Xms1G:设置初始内存为 1GB。-Xmx1G:设置最大内存为 1GB,你可以根据你的服务器内存调整这个值。
- 首次运行会自动关闭,并生成
eula.txt文件和world文件夹。
-
同意服务条款:
(图片来源网络,侵删)- 用记事本打开
eula.txt文件。 - 将
eula=false修改为eula=true。 - 保存并关闭文件。
- 用记事本打开
-
配置服务器:
- 用记事本打开
server.properties文件,这里可以设置服务器的基本信息:server-ip=:留空,表示绑定所有IP,如果你想局域网玩,就保持默认。server-port=25565:服务器端口,默认是25565,如需修改请确保防火墙允许。motd=An Minecraft 1.10.2 Server:服务器在列表里显示的名称。online-mode=true:强烈建议保持为true,这会验证玩家的正版账号,防止恶意玩家入侵。max-players=20:最大玩家数量。gamemode=survival:默认游戏模式(生存/创造/冒险/旁观)。difficulty=normal:默认难度(和平/简单/普通/困难)。
- 用记事本打开
-
启动服务器:
- 再次在命令行中运行:
java -Xms1G -Xmx1G -jar minecraft_server.1.10.2.jar nogui - 现在服务器就启动了!命令行窗口会显示服务器日志。不要关闭这个窗口,否则服务器会停止。
- 再次在命令行中运行:
-
连接服务器:
- 在你的 Minecraft 客户端中,选择“多人游戏” -> “添加服务器”。
- 服务器名称:随便填一个你喜欢的名字。
- 服务器地址:如果你的服务器在本地,就填
localhost或0.0.1,如果要在局域网内连接,填服务器的局域网 IP (如168.1.100),如果要让外网朋友连接,需要设置端口转发或使用内网穿透工具,地址填你的公网 IP。 - 点击“完成”,然后双击服务器名称即可进入。
搭建模组服务器
这是 1.10.2 服务器最常见的形式,因为它拥有最丰富的模组生态。
准备工作:
- 和原版服务器一样,需要 Java 8 和一个服务器文件夹。
- 一个模组管理工具,强烈推荐使用
Feed The Beast (FTB)的ModLauncher或CurseForge ( curseforge.com ),手动管理几十上百个模组及其依赖关系是一场噩梦。
使用 CurseForge 搭建模组服务器(推荐):
-
下载 CurseForge App:
- 访问 https://www.curseforge.com/download 下载并安装 CurseForge 客户端。
-
创建实例:
- 打开 CurseForge App,点击左上角的 "New Instance" (新建实例)。
- 在 Minecraft 版本列表中,选择 Minecraft 1.10.2。
- 你可以选择一个现成的 Modpack(模组包),也可以选择 "Create Empty Instance" (创建空实例) 来自己手动添加模组,对于新手,选择一个热门的模组包(如 FTB 的某个包)是最佳选择。
-
安装模组:
- 在你的实例界面,点击 "Mods" (模组) 标签。
- 你会看到一个模组列表,你可以在这里搜索、添加或移除模组,每个模组页面都有 "Download" 按钮,但服务器端通常需要下载带有 "Server" 标签的文件。
- 关键:区分客户端模组和服务器端模组,有些模组(如 Tinkers' Construct)需要客户端和服务器端都安装,而有些模组(如 Mekanism)只需要服务器端安装,客户端通过资源包即可看到内容,仔细阅读模组描述。
-
提取服务器端文件:
- 在 CurseForge App 中,点击实例旁边的 "..." 按钮,选择 "Export Server" (导出服务器)。
- App 会自动生成一个包含所有服务器端必要文件(包括
minecraft_server.1.10.2.jar和所有.jar格式的模组)的压缩包。 - 将这个压缩包解压到你之前准备好的服务器文件夹中。
-
启动模组服务器:
- 使用命令行进入该文件夹。
- 运行启动命令:
java -Xms2G -Xmx4G -jar forge.jar nogui- 注意:这里启动的文件通常是
forge.jar或server.jar,而不是官方的minecraft_server.jar,因为 Forge 会加载所有模组。 - 模组服务器通常需要更多的内存,
-Xmx的值可以适当调大一些(如 2G, 4G, 6G 等)。
- 注意:这里启动的文件通常是
- 首次启动会生成
eula.txt,同样需要将其中的eula=false改为eula=true。 - 再次运行启动命令,服务器就会加载所有模组并启动。
-
连接服务器:
- 玩家在启动 Minecraft 时,必须选择同一个模组包对应的实例,或者手动安装相同的客户端模组,才能成功连接到模组服务器。
- 连接方式和原版服务器一样,在“多人游戏”中添加服务器地址。
常用管理工具和服务端
- **服务端
